We often see a zoo where animals are put behind the bars or the "open concept" kind of zoo in Singapore where the animals are enclosed in their natural settings. But my experienced in Taman Safari I Indonesia yesterday was totally unique where "we" are the one in the cage instead of the wild animals. The cage I'm referring to was our car which we use to go around. It is a drive - thru safari style zoo. Animals are set free and wandering around the car and on the streets. We bought 3 bundles of carrots along the road for only 20,000 rupiahs to feed them. Thanks to the woman selling it, she gave us big discounts for it. All carrots we bought are still fresh. It is pretty neat to feed the animals from our car window. We are asked to close our car windows when we enter the Wildlife Zone. We saw lots of African lion, Bengal tiger, cheetah and others.
